[QUOTE="raceanoncr, post: 249577, member: 6408"] You will be put thru a, likely, abbreviated training period like friend/t feeder drivers. On first day, it will probably be road test, to see if you kill anybody while driving. Maybe just tractor, maybe just tractor and 1 trailer. Some classroom work. Slowly you'll learn how to build sets, THE UPS WAY! Yeah, right. You will be trained to double-clutch, which is living in the stone age, but you wanna pass? Do everything you're required to. When you're alone, you can ditch the double-clutching or whatever else habits you're into. Just be safe and go slow. Speed tractor depends on where you are located. Some still have 5-spds. Some 7-spds. Some 8, most 10 now. Just keep shifting til you run outta gears. [/QUOTE]
